Separate market potential from ability to enter

An attractive market is not necessarily accessible. The file distinguishes potential demand, competitive intensity, regulatory constraints, available channels and the organization’s actual ability to operate.

Compare several entry modes

The decision file compares progressive forms of commitment, including their timing, cost, dependencies and exit options.

OptionPotential benefitWatch point
Direct entryControl of the relationshipBuild cost and lead time
Local partnerFaster accessDependency and value sharing
Bounded pilotLimited learning investmentRepresentativeness of the test
AcquisitionExisting capabilitiesIntegration and capital committed

Define a staged commitment

A robust decision may fund a test rather than a full launch. The deliverable states the learning question, maximum spend, expected result, stop condition and review date.

  • Target market and segment
  • Selected entry mode
  • Commercial assumptions
  • Critical dependencies
  • Learning milestone and next decision
